A Robust Biometric Authentication and PIN Distribution Technique for Secure Mobile Commerce Applications

Abstract

In a mobile emerging world, user authentication, service provider authentication and security is very important in mobile commerce. User authentication is performed by using fingerprint based biometric methodology. Existing system used for Mobile purchasing/payment services in handheld devices does not analyze fingerprint matching and feature extraction techniques in an efficient way. Also the existing system is not secure and accurate for m-payments applications. We propose secure, efficient and accurate m-commerce architecture for m-commerce applications. This involves fusion of Minutiae Maps (MM) and Orientation Maps (OM) for fingerprint feature extraction. The fingerprint is sent to the biometric server in a secure way using Discrete Wavelet Transform (DWT) data hiding method. User fingerprint will be checked and compared using MM and OM methods to figure out the fingerprint threshold matching score. If the threshold is 80-99% PIN distribution process is initiated, otherwise user authentication is failed. The user PIN is converted into a unique sequence and divided into two parts. Along with the user PIN, user IP address, time stamp, user ID are encrypted using RC4 (stream cipher) algorithm. Also a hash function is appended to the cipher text using Secure Hash Algorithm (SHA4). One half is verified by the authentication server and the other half is verified by the external server. After verification both the servers sends only OK message to the bank. This study looks to provide a high secure and efficient solution for m-commerce applications.
